On 07.10.22 01:15, Jeff Davis wrote: > + * Call ucol_strcollUTF8(), ucol_strcoll(), strcoll(), strcoll_l(), wcscoll(), > + * or wcscoll_l() as appropriate for the given locale, platform, and database > + * encoding. Arguments must be NUL-terminated. If the locale is not specified, > + * use the database collation. > + * > + * If the collation is deterministic, break ties with memcmp(), and then with > + * the string length. > + */ > +int > +pg_strcoll(const char *arg1, int len1, const char *arg2, int len2, > + pg_locale_t locale) It's a bit confusing that arguments must be NUL-terminated, but the length is still specified. Maybe another sentence to explain that would be helpful. The length arguments ought to be of type size_t, I think.
